About Kasha

Kasha is an unsigned English rapper from Charlton, London and part of a production team called Vivid Imagery. Kasha has been labelled ‘the strongest lyricist in the UK’ by Kiss100, he has been likened vocally to Tupac and has been described as a breath of freshest air for Hip Hop. His style of rap is warm yet raw, emotional yet punky. He tells serious stories of his surroundings, the problems in the world and his dreams but he always has time to throw in some fun every once and a while. Unlike most hip hop the music is melody driven, choosing only the most energetic or soulfulness of beats. This is international Hip Hop but with all the excitement of the UK sound.

On April 6th 2009 Kasha will release his debut album called ‘The Oracle’, which is designed to bring back the essence of the early 90’s hip hop but with 21st century quality. The Oracle adds to this lyrically strong, musically rich hip hop era and opens up the sound to new ears, the rap style is melodic and fresh and opens up the to people who never really new they liked hip hop. On top of this it adds the positive wisdom and experience of a young man growing up in the UK.

Kasha continually involves himself in many projects and in Mid 2009 he will release a charity single and video entitled ‘You Have A Choice’ which is officially backed by the MET Police. Its intention is to reduce knife and gun crime on our streets by tackling the problem at source. Kasha has already headlined this track at the NEC and Arsenal’s Emirates Stadium with support from Chipmunk and has many more performances coming in 2009.

Kasha has worked with actors such as Frank Harper from ‘Lock Stock and Two Smoking Barrels’ and Kasha also provided one of the lead tracks alongside Klashnekoff and Kyza on ‘The Sting Operation’. This is a 20 track release that’s been very successful in Germany and is highly revered amongst it’s hip hop scene. A further international collaboration from Kasha is his work for the American Album ‘King’s Pawn’, which inserted Kasha into the almost impervious USA hip-hop scene. Kasha also makes an appearance on the ‘People’s Army Album’ which is due for release in 2009. The Album will feature many rap artists from the UK’s ‘End of the Weak’ and ‘People’s Army’ movements. Recently Kasha remixed Estelle’s American boy into a version called American Girl, the track was released on a small scale to his fans and a few dj’s as a bit of fun but the track soon found itself playing on several commercial radio stations and clocking up over 100000 plays across the internet. Another notable success for Kasha and Vivid Imagery was the signing of a sponsorship deal in 2007 with an American trainer company called Kashi Kicks and earning the finalist status in the Hugo Urban Rules competition of 2008.

“The MCs are the usual roll call of London underground” “though newcomer Kasha excels”
Touch Magazine Review of the Beezwax Album

With tracks selling around the globe, airplay on Kiss, Choice, Xfm, BBC 1xtra and Galaxy, appearances on MTV and TMF, Kasha’s unique and diverse approach to music is cutting through the market. UK rap has finally come of age.
